Y.M (Any two) The memory in an 8086 based system is organised as segmented memory and this memory management technique is called as segmentation. The complete physically memory is divided into a number of logical segments in segmentation. WebThe acculatator is 16 bit wide and is called: AX; AH; AL; DL; 7. WebApr 8, 2024 · The 8086 (like most computers) represents signed numbers using a format called two's complement. While a regular byte holds a number from 0 to 255, a signed byte holds a number from -128 to 127.
